Kai is member of the Management Board of Union Investment Luxembourg S.A. and in charge of Risk Management, Valuation, Corporate Governance and Central Delegation & IT. He started his career in the fund industry 2004 as risk analyst at Union Investment Management Holding, Frankfurt. After an interruption of 4 years, where he hold a management position as conducting officer for Risk and Compliance and as an On-Site inspector at the CSSF, he re-joined Union Investment Group in 2018. He holds a Masters`s degree in Economics from the University of Mainz and is a certified FRM.
Two years ago, the European Risk Management Conference featured a session on “Real assets and semi-open structures”. After the introduction of ELTIF, the panel will take stock of the evolution and progress made in designing new products for retail investors. In this discussion, liquidity remains a central theme as a source of both opportunities and concerns to reach the promises made by ELTIF. In practice, investment managers have substantially called for risk managers help to achieve ELTIF design, launch and operations. The panellists will review what is in the remit of the risk manager is such a project. Drawing from their experience, the ELTIF pioneers will identify the challenges they faced and compare their sometimes diverging responses. The session will conclude on the most important updates to the risk management framework needed to onboard ELTIF products, differentiating between the launching and day-to-day phases.
